A tech firm in Greater London is seeking a UX Researcher to drive impactful user research across various product areas. The ideal candidate should have 2-3 years of UX research experience and possess strong user-centred thinking, effective communication skills, and collaborate well with teams.
Responsibilities include:
- Conducting user studies
- Analysing data
- Presenting findings to stakeholders
This hands-on role offers the chance to shape product experiences using insights and contributes to a diverse and inclusive work environ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Awin Global
✨Know Your UX Research Fundamentals
Brush up on your UX research methodologies and be ready to discuss them. Make sure you can explain how you've applied user-centred thinking in your previous projects, as this will show your understanding of the role's core requirements.
✨Prepare Your Case Studies
Have a couple of impactful case studies ready to share. Focus on your end-to-end research processes, from planning and conducting studies to analysing data and presenting insights. This will demonstrate your hands-on experience and ability to drive meaningful outcomes.
✨Practice Effective Communication
Since effective communication is key, practice articulating your findings clearly and concisely. Think about how you would present your insights to stakeholders who may not have a technical background, ensuring your message is accessible and engaging.
✨Show Your Collaborative Spirit
Be prepared to discuss how you've worked with cross-functional teams in the past. Highlight specific examples where your collaboration led to improved product experiences, as this aligns with the company's emphasis on teamwork and inclusivity.
